What is Kepler's First Law?
Back
Kepler's First Law states that planets move in elliptical orbits with the Sun at one of the two foci.

What are the two focal points in an elliptical orbit?
Back
The two focal points are points in space where the sum of the distances from any point on the ellipse to the two foci is constant.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
How does the eccentricity of an orbit relate to its shape?
Back
Eccentricity measures how much an orbit deviates from being circular; a value of 0 is a perfect circle, while values closer to 1 indicate more elongated ellipses.
